Quick Facts
  • Parents are Elizabeth and Patrick
  • Has a twin sister Jessica
  • Started playing tennis at age seven
  • Her favorite tournament is Indian Wells, favorite Grand Slam is the Australian Open, and her favorite surface is clay
  • Tennis idols growing up were Justine Henin and Lleyton Hewitt
  • Enjoys spending time outdoors, listening to music and hanging with friends and family.
Career Highlights
  • Reached her first major final at the 2021 Australian Open, where she lost to Naomi Osaka
  • In 2020, recorded her first No. 1 victory over Maria Sharapova
  • Won one WTA singles title, one WTA doubles title as well as four singles and five doubles titles on the ITF Circuit.
  • Part of the UCLA team that won the 2014 NCAA National Championship
